Navigating Tax Implications for Small Businesses
Running a small business involves both excitement and challenges. One of the most crucial aspects to consider is understanding the tax implications that come with operating your own company. Failing to properly navigate these complexities could cause significant financial burdens down the road.
Begin by establish a solid understanding of the different tax classes that apply to small businesses. This includes federal income taxes, state and local taxes, sales taxes, and potentially employment taxes. It's also crucial to maintain meticulous financial records. These records will be essential when filing your tax returns and can help you identify potential deductions or credits that could be eligible for.

Streamlining Payroll Processes for Efficiency and Accuracy
In today's rapidly evolving business landscape, it is crucial to optimize every aspect of your operations for maximum effectiveness. One area that often demands attention is payroll processing. By implementing methods to streamline your payroll processes, you can significantly improve both accuracy and efficiency, saving time, reducing errors, and freeing up valuable resources.
Utilizing automated payroll software is a fundamental step in this endeavor. This technology can automate many of the tedious and repetitive tasks associated with payroll, such as calculating earnings, processing deductions, and generating pay stubs. By leveraging automation, you can reduce the risk of human error and ensure timely and accurate payment to your employees.
Furthermore, a well-defined payroll policy is essential for transparency. This policy should clearly outline all aspects of payroll, including pay rates, overtime policies, deductions, and payment schedules. By communicating these policies effectively to both employees and managers, you can minimize confusion and foster a culture of compliance.
- Continuously review your payroll processes to identify areas for enhancement.
- Remain up-to-date on the latest industry best practices and legal mandates related to payroll.
By taking these steps, you can streamline your payroll processes, ensuring accuracy, efficiency, and a positive experience for both your employees and your organization.
